The Meaning Behind Majjiga Mirapakayalu

The name itself explains the soul of the dish majjiga means buttermilk and mirapakayalu means chillies. Fresh green chillies are slit carefully soaked in spiced buttermilk and dried under the hot sun. This process reduces raw heat while infusing deep tangy flavor. What emerges is not just a snack but a preserved delicacy that can be enjoyed throughout the year. The Traditional Process That Makes It Special

Authentic Majjiga Mirapakayalu preparation is a multi day process. Fresh chillies are cleaned slit and soaked in spiced buttermilk mixed with salt and asafoetida. Each day they are sun dried and re soaked until they absorb the flavor fully. Only then are they dried completely and stored. A Comfort Side Dish for Everyday Meals

One reason Majjiga Mirapakayalu became a staple is its versatility. Deep fried until crisp it pairs perfectly with hot rice and ghee adding crunch and tang. It also complements curd rice dal and simple vegetable meals. During summers when cooking heavy dishes feels tiring this fried accompaniment adds instant flavor. Preserving Food the Natural Way

Before refrigeration Andhra homes relied on sun drying and fermentation to preserve food. Majjiga Mirapakayalu is a prime example of this intelligent traditional practice. Buttermilk acts as a natural preservative while sun drying removes moisture safely.
